Does the opportunity to shape the health and wellbeing of Leicestershire’s population interest you?
Public Health at Leicestershire County Council are looking for 7 Public Health Practitioner Apprentices, based in the Health Improvement team.
You will play an active role in supporting the Health Improvement team to implement and deliver health improvement programmes/projects, support health campaigns and deliver aspects of the current Public Health strategy.

About the role
This is a 3-year fixed term career graded post, where you will study for a degree in Public Health at Coventry University alongside working full time, gaining the knowledge, skills and experience across the various Public Health services, such as health improvement and health protection, as well as working within the local District and Borough Councils gaining understanding of the wider determinants of health such as education, transport, and housing.

We are looking for flexible and motivated individuals with excellent communication and organisational skills.

You will be joining a friendly team in a progressive authority that supports the development of its employees through continuous professional development. You will also be offered placements with partner organisations or other teams in the council to expand your skills and knowledge and the opportunity to network with other apprentices in the Council.

The post offers smarter ways of working with a combination of office and home working available. 
An enhanced DBS check (no barred list check) is required for this post.
